Output 538322511a926e89c2b066d95c586399c8a2d7c0a109dabdb346b64d1821d7ae:0

value
562162
script pubkey
OP_0 OP_PUSHBYTES_20 42444e7a2dfd530a508e3bfb9741e8549d9f8aeb
address
bc1qgfzyu73dl4fs55yw80aews0g2jwelzhtx8qv6j
transaction
538322511a926e89c2b066d95c586399c8a2d7c0a109dabdb346b64d1821d7ae
spent
true